NodeJs安装npm包一直失败的解决方法


Posted in NodeJs onApril 28, 2017

最近在学React,在gitHub上下载一个项目下来,安装node.js后发现用npm install就一直报错,不知道怎么解决,查了很多资料 都没有用。

在windows下 cmd到命令窗口 (最好是管理员的身份运行),结果就如下图01

NodeJs安装npm包一直失败的解决方法

才开始学 不清楚什么错误,感觉和npm无关,查资料说是更改npm的安装源

可以使用npm config list 查看当前配置的状况,说可能是某些包被国内墙了 需要操作

npm config set strict-ssl false       //关闭npm的https 
npm config set registry "http://registry.npmjs.org/"    //重新设置npm的获取地址

或者直接编辑c盘下的.npmrc文件,将registry的值修改为:

registry = http://registry.npmjs.org/

但是发现都没有什么用

再者,说是用淘宝镜像 ,我也试了 ,没什么用 

npm config set registry https://registry.npm.taobao.org

最后 终于找到了用代理 是代理的问题,直接

npm config set proxy http://address:8080     注意这里的address我开始不知道是什么地址 就直接写的本电脑的IP地址 结果就可以了

主要是参考http://stackoverflow.com/questions/23193614/npm-err-network-getaddrinfo-enotfound

另外,清除npm的代理命令如下:

npm config delete http-proxy
npm config delete https-proxy

以上只代表个人的情况。

以上就是本文的全部内容,希望本文的内容对大家的学习或者工作能带来一定的帮助,同时也希望多多支持三水点靠木!

NodeJs 相关文章推荐
Nodejs实现的一个简单udp广播服务器、客户端
Sep 25 NodeJs
nodejs教程之异步I/O
Nov 21 NodeJs
轻松创建nodejs服务器(4):路由
Dec 18 NodeJs
Highcharts+NodeJS搭建数据可视化平台示例
Jan 01 NodeJs
使用 NodeJS+Express 开发服务端的简单介绍
Apr 07 NodeJs
Nodejs--post的公式详解
Apr 29 NodeJs
mac下的nodejs环境安装的步骤
May 24 NodeJs
NodeJS父进程与子进程资源共享原理与实现方法
Mar 16 NodeJs
nodejs用gulp管理前端文件方法
Jun 24 NodeJs
详解nodejs解压版安装和配置(带有搭建前端项目脚手架)
Dec 06 NodeJs
NodeJS实现同步的方法
Mar 02 NodeJs
nodejs实现百度舆情接口应用示例
Feb 07 NodeJs
NodeJs模拟登陆正方教务
Apr 28 #NodeJs
用Nodejs搭建服务器访问html、css、JS等静态资源文件
Apr 28 #NodeJs
Nodejs读取文件时相对路径的正确写法(使用fs模块)
Apr 27 #NodeJs
详解nodejs express下使用redis管理session
Apr 24 #NodeJs
nodejs入门教程六:express模块用法示例
Apr 24 #NodeJs
Nodejs进阶:express+session实现简易登录身份认证
Apr 24 #NodeJs
nodejs入门教程五:连接数据库的方法分析
Apr 24 #NodeJs
You might like
PHP数据库操作面向对象的优点
2006/10/09 PHP
php下实现农历日历的代码
2007/03/07 PHP
php程序总是提示验证码输入有误解决方案
2015/01/07 PHP
php实现的简单日志写入函数
2015/03/31 PHP
Mootools 1.2教程 定时器和哈希简介
2009/09/15 Javascript
JavaScript 匿名函数(anonymous function)与闭包(closure)
2011/10/04 Javascript
JS打开层/关闭层/移动层动画效果的实例代码
2013/05/11 Javascript
jquery的ajax异步请求接收返回json数据实例
2014/06/16 Javascript
Javascript堆排序算法详解
2014/12/03 Javascript
JavaScript+html5 canvas制作色彩斑斓的正方形效果
2016/01/27 Javascript
JavaScript中的原型继承基础学习教程
2016/05/06 Javascript
jQuery获取与设置iframe高度的方法
2016/08/01 Javascript
Bootstrap CDN和本地化环境搭建
2016/10/26 Javascript
JavaScript生成.xls文件的代码
2016/12/22 Javascript
BootstrapValidator实现注册校验和登录错误提示效果
2017/03/10 Javascript
Web纯前端“旭日图”实现元素周期表
2017/03/10 Javascript
vue-cli如何添加less 以及sass
2017/07/06 Javascript
微信小程序常用简易小函数总结
2019/02/01 Javascript
小程序数据通信方法大全(推荐)
2019/04/15 Javascript
通过实例了解js函数中参数的传递
2019/06/15 Javascript
原生js实现可兼容PC和移动端的拖动滑块功能详解【测试可用】
2019/08/15 Javascript
[58:54]EG vs RNG 2019国际邀请赛小组赛 BO2 第一场 8.16
2019/08/18 DOTA
Python 绘图库 Matplotlib 入门教程
2018/04/19 Python
Python文件常见操作实例分析【读写、遍历】
2018/12/10 Python
使用Python轻松完成垃圾分类(基于图像识别)
2019/07/09 Python
用Python+OpenCV对比图像质量的几种方法
2019/07/15 Python
python实现图片九宫格分割
2021/03/07 Python
详解Python中字符串前“b”,“r”,“u”,“f”的作用
2019/12/18 Python
Python读取文件内容为字符串的方法(多种方法详解)
2020/03/04 Python
HTML5 Canvas的性能提高技巧经验分享
2013/07/02 HTML / CSS
HTML5 history新特性pushState、replaceState及两者的区别
2015/12/26 HTML / CSS
部队领导证婚词
2014/01/12 职场文书
党员检讨书
2014/10/13 职场文书
2015年助残日活动总结
2015/03/27 职场文书
2016年党员干部公开承诺书
2016/03/24 职场文书
Java Dubbo框架知识点梳理
2021/06/26 Java/Android